TEXAS STATE HIGHWAY 180
'State Highway 180', or 'SH 180', is a highway that runs through Tarrant County and Dallas County in Texas (USA). The highway begins as Lancaster Avenue from Interstate 35W just southeast of downtown Fort Worth. When it enters Arlington, it becomes Division Street. After entering Grand Prairie, it becomes Main Street. When it enters Dallas, it becomes Davis Street before becoming 8th street just east of Zang Boulevard in the Oak Cliff area of Dallas,. From there it travels a short distance to Interstate 35E. The route was designated in 1991 to replace US 80 when it was decommissioned west of Dallas.

Previous routes
'SH 180' was previously designated by 1933 as a connector route from Annona north to then-SH 5. This route was redesignated as FM 44 by 1942.
